2月 122015
 
Pocket

時系列順に説明。

/kcsapi/api_req_combined_battle/battleresult

まず戦闘結果。

  • api_escapeがある場合、護衛退避の確認画面に移行
  • api_escape_flagも存在するが、使われていない模様
  • api_escape_idx
    • 大破した艦のインデックス番号の配列
    • 第1艦隊が1~6、第2艦隊が7~12を振られている
    • 複数返ってくる場合もある
  • api_tow_idx
    • 護衛できる駆逐艦のインデックス番号の配列
    • 第1艦隊が1~6、第2艦隊が7~12を振られている
    • 複数返ってくる場合もある
  • api_escape_idxapi_tow_idxそれぞれの最初の艦が選択され、表示される
  • 大破した艦と護衛出来る艦が複数あったとしても、1度しか退避確認が行われないため、最初の艦しか離脱できない
/kcsapi/api_req_combined_battle/goback_port

次に護衛退避を承諾するAPI。

  • 護衛退避の確認画面にて「退避」を選択した場合にgoback_portが呼ばれる
  • 「退避せず」を選択した場合は、goback_port呼ばれない
  • 中身は空っぽ
/kcsapi/api_req_combined_battle/battle_water

退避後の次の戦闘。
goback_portからこれまでの間に/kcsapi/api_get_member/ship2/kcsapi/api_req_map/nextが入るはず。

※連合艦隊-水上部隊の例。
 api_req_combined_battle以下のAPIは他数種類あるが、以下のパラメータは同様のはず。
 API一覧は艦これAPI一覧参照。

  • api_escape_idx
    • 第1艦隊で退避済みの艦のインデックス番号の配列
    • 範囲は1~6
  • api_escape_idx_combined
    • 第2艦隊で退避済みの艦のインデックス番号の配列
    • 範囲は1~6

 Leave a Reply